     Your Committee on Health, to which was referred H.R. No. 149 entitled:

 

"HOUSE RESOLUTION REQUESTING THE DEPARTMENT OF PSYCHIATRY OF THE UNIVERSITY OF HAWAII AT MANOA TO CONVENE A MENTAL HEALTH ACCESS TASK FORCE AND REQUESTING THE AUDITOR TO COMPLETE A MENTAL HEALTH WORKFORCE ASSESSMENT,"

 

begs leave to report as follows:

 

     The purpose of this measure is to improve mental health care in the State by requesting:

 

(1) The University of Hawaii at Manoa to convene a Mental Health Access Task Force; and

 

(2) The auditor to complete and submit a mental health workforce assessment of mental health professionals and mental health facilities in Hawaii. 

 

     An individual testified in support of this measure with comments.  Several individuals testified in opposition to this measure.

 

     Your Committee finds that the purpose of this measure would be better addressed with a working group rather than a task force and that a request to the auditor is addressed in a separate measure.

 

     Accordingly, your Committee has amended this measure by:

 

(1)  Changing the title to read: "REQUESTING THE CONVENING OF A MENTAL HEALTH ACCESS WORKING GROUP";

 

(2)  Replacing references to a task force with reference to a working group;

 

(4)  Removing references to the auditor; and

 

(3)  Making technical, nonsubstantive amendments for clarity, Consistency, and style.

 

     As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Health that is attached to this report, your Committee concurs with the intent and purpose of H.R. No. 149, as amended herein, and recommends that it be referred to the Committee on Higher Education in the form attached hereto as H.R. No. 149, H.D. 1.
